Nick Padmore, Lotus 77, Masters Racing Legends, two races of twenty minutes for F1 cars from the years 1966 to 1985, split into four classes, Jackie Stewart, Patrick Head, Niki Lauder, and Emerson Fittipaldi, according to the year of construction and whether they are flat bottomed or incorporate the ground effect, Masters Historic Racing, Masters Historic Festival, on the Brands Hatch Grand Prix Circuit, 28th May 2023, Longfield, Kent DA3 8NG, England

Glazed with durable thick 2mm Acrylic to provide a virtually unbreakable glass-like finish. Acrylic Glass is far safer, more flexible and much lighter than typical mineral glass. Moreover, its higher translucency makes it a perfect carrier for photo prints. Acrylic allows a little more light to penetrate the surface than conventional glass and absorbs UV rays so that the image and the picture quality doesn't suffer under direct sunlight even after many years.
